Patrick C. Cabaitan, Ph.D. – Professor

Contact:
pcabaitan@msi.upd.edu.ph

Education:
Ph.D. Marine Science, University of the Ryukus, Japan

Research Interests:
Community Ecology, Restoration Ecology, Giant Clam Conservation
